This article explains practical compliance and survey-preparedness themes for skilled nursing facilities, including how to assess internal risk, keep pace with changing operations, prepare for inspections, address turnover and training demands, and use routine audits to review resident records. It is aimed at long-term care leaders, administrators, and compliance staff who need a broad view of operational risk management and quality-of-care oversight.
Why This Topic Matters
Facilities operating in a highly regulated environment need clear internal processes to reduce compliance exposure and to identify problems before survey activity or enforcement action creates larger risk.
